Yes, many properties are getting covered, and I agree comedies and such have not gotten as much attention as they deserve, so that is something we'd like to see covered more too. Regardless of the properties that have been done, there are many accessories that may not exist for such properties. That's what we're looking for. Example; maybe all those people that got Spenser's Doc & Marty want a hoverboard. That's what we're looking for in accessories. Likewise, we're very interested in general non licensed items. For example, we're doing the Banjo for Tallahassee from Zombieland. Sure it's as seen in the movie, but the Banjo doesn't "say" Zombieland. It's not a licensed item, and safe for us to produce in larger quantities.

Take the accessories we're making for Max. You put them all together, and sure it's obviously for Mad Max, but individually, they're just generic items that could be used for other projects.

I have also created a new Coffee Mug, which we'll be able to cast up and offer with many different logos such as Initech from Office Space or #1 Boss for The Office, etc. The possibilities are endless with a simple coffee mug. Sure they exist in other forms, but this one's a different design than others I've seen, and we get to make them so it's cheaper. I'll post pictures of that mug soon.

Clothing and cloth items are another option, though not too elaborate yet. For example, we produced a Grim Reaper robe, which sold out quick (more to come). We're going to make Tallahassee's V-Neck t-shirt, but then we can reproduce this shirt design in all different colors and styles. We're going to make neckties with patterns on them such as Clark Griswold's from Christmas Vacation. Any specific ties needed? These are what we're looking for.
